Output 8e661c6e1c7384a375bf6c9a5dec77daf8d3e75985a177ea13c9865144d1217c:30

value
173200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 221d2f37666ce74951b9c4853ce2b9e669131821 OP_EQUAL
address
34oPrqTnXtydWYuHvAiSAxWcJUB1KJtkPQ
transaction
8e661c6e1c7384a375bf6c9a5dec77daf8d3e75985a177ea13c9865144d1217c